diplomatic

听听怎么读
英 [ˌdɪpləˈmætɪk]
美 [ˌdɪpləˈmætɪk]
是什么意思
  • adj.

    外交上的;外交人员的;有手腕的;策略的

  • 双语释义

    adj.(形容词)
    1. 外交上的,外交人员的relating to diplomacy or diplomats
    2. 有手腕的,策略的,善于交涉的,圆滑的skilled in dealing with people

    英英释义

    diplomatic[ ,diplə'mætik ]

    • adj.
      • relating to or characteristic of diplomacy

        "diplomatic immunity"

      • skilled in dealing with sensitive matters or people

        同义词:diplomatical

    学习怎么用

    词汇搭配

    用作形容词 (adj.)
    ~+名词
    • a diplomatic person圆滑的人
    • diplomatic relation外交关系
    ~+介词
    • diplomatic in doing sth在做某事时慎重

    词组短语

    diplomatic relations外交关系

    diplomatic ties外交关系;邦交

    diplomatic mission使馆;外交使团

    establishment of diplomatic relations建交;建立外交关系

    diplomatic immunityn. 外交豁免权

    diplomatic channels外交途径

    diplomatic recognition外交承认

    diplomatic servicen. 外交部门;驻外部门

    diplomatic practice外交惯例

    diplomatic courier外交信使

    双语例句

    用作形容词(adj.)
    1. He has diplomatic immunity.
      他有外交豁免权。
    2. The exercise of patience is essential in diplomatic negotiations.
      在外交谈判中,重要的是要有耐性。
    3. He tried to be diplomatic when he refused their invitation.
      他在拒绝他们的邀请时,尽可能地婉转些。
    4. John was as diplomatic as Mary when talking to the press.
      约翰在与媒体打交道时和玛丽一样老练。
